We are hiring a Teacher Assistant, also known as a Teacher's Aide, to work under the direction of the classroom teacher to provide extra support to students with special needs, promoting maximum academic and personal growth. They are also known as paraprofessionals, professional aides, instructional aides, one-to-one aides, etc.

Responsibilities
- The Teacher Assistant aides in the instruction of individual EC students or groups of EC students in all curricular areas as directed by the teacher.
- Collects data to document individual student progress on IEP goals.
- Plans and works with the teacher in devising instructional strategies.
- Operates and cares for equipment and materials for both classroom and individual students.
- Assists and supervises during emergency drills, assemblies, play periods, field trips and to other designated places.
- Acts as a bus monitor when special needs of an EC student(s) are identified by the IEP team.
- Alerts the teacher to any problem or special information about an individual student.
- Participates in in-service training programs for professional growth.
- Assists in checking materials and portfolios, correcting papers, supervising, and testing as directed by the teacher.
- Assists in keeping bulletin boards and other learning centers current.
- Assists in school routines and transitions.
- Assists with student attendance procedures, record keeping, collecting money, ordering materials and other duties as assigned.
- Provides physical assistance to students as needed in the areas of self-help, clothing, toileting (including accidents and catheterizing).
- Provides physical assistance to therapists and teachers as needed in duties related to occupational and physical therapy and mainstreaming classes.
- Provides physical assistance as needed to students by writing assignments under the direction of the teacher.
- Provides physical assistance as needed to students by lifting, positioning and by pushing wheelchairs.
